Abstract
Cell growth and ginseng saponin production by suspension cultures of Panax ginseng were investigated under various initial sucrose concentrations and inoculum sizes. Cell growth was low at a low inoculum size of 1.5 g DW/1, a nd the maximum cell growth rate was obtained at 3 g DW/1 of inoculum size. A cell density of 22.4 g/l was obtained at inoculum size of 6 g DW/1 and in itial sucrose concentration of 60 g/l after 26 days cultivation. The maximu m cell yield of 0.83 was obtained at inoculum size of 3 g DW/1 and initial sucrose level of 30 g/l. Saponin biosynthesis was stimulated with high init ial sucrose concentrations (60-80 g/l), and the maximum saponin production of 275 mg/l was achieved at 6 g/l of inoculum size and 60 g/l initial mediu m sucrose.
